The clinical association of left atrial appendage thrombus on CTA with functional outcome

Left atrial appendage (LAA) thrombus in patients with acute stroke or TIA is linked to worse outcomes. Computed tomography angiography (CTA) can identify LAA thrombus, a predictor of poorer 3-month functional status.

Area of Science:

  • Cardiology
  • Neurology
  • Radiology

Background:

  • Left atrial appendage (LAA) thrombus is a known complication of atrial fibrillation (AF) and a potential indicator of atrial cardiomyopathy.
  • The presence of LAA thrombus in patients experiencing acute ischemic stroke or transient ischemic attack (TIA) requires further investigation regarding its prognostic implications.

Purpose of the Study:

  • To determine the association between computed tomography angiography (CTA)-identified LAA thrombus and 3-month outcomes in patients presenting with acute ischemic stroke or TIA.
  • To evaluate LAA thrombus as an independent predictor of functional outcome after acute cerebrovascular events.

Main Methods:

  • A dual-centre, retrospective cohort study was conducted, including consecutive patients who presented with acute ischemic stroke or TIA and underwent acute stroke imaging.
  • Data on CTA-LAA thrombus and 3-month modified Rankin Scale (mRS) scores were analyzed.
  • Multivariable logistic regression models were employed to adjust for known predictors of outcome.

Main Results:

  • Of 1435 patients, 58 (4.0%) had CTA-LAA thrombus. These patients were older, more frequently female, and had higher rates of AF, heart failure, and medium or large vessel occlusion (MLVO).
  • Patients with CTA-LAA thrombus exhibited significantly higher 3-month mortality (28% vs 11%).
  • After adjusting for confounding factors, LAA thrombus was independently associated with an increased 3-month mRS score (OR: 2.02, 95% CI: 1.20-3.40).

Conclusions:

  • CTA-identified LAA thrombus during acute stroke imaging is a significant predictor of worse functional outcome at 3 months in patients with ischemic stroke or TIA.
  • This finding highlights the importance of assessing LAA status in acute stroke patients to identify individuals at higher risk for adverse outcomes.
